The Hanwoo Niche and the Mongtan Opportunity

At the apex of Korean cuisine is Hanwoo, a breed of cattle native to Korea renowned for its incredible marbling and flavor, often compared to Japanese Wagyu. While Hanwoo represents the zenith of Korean Beef Excellence, its limited availability and high cost make it a niche product in the global market. Mongtan's brilliant insight is to apply the *principles* of Hanwoothe meticulous care, specific cuts, and precise preparationto high-quality, carefully selected American beef. This allows the brand to deliver a transcendent beef experience that is both accessible and exceptional. It's a pragmatic yet visionary approach that honors Korean culinary heritage while adapting to the realities of the Mongtan US market, creating a unique and defensible market position.

The Cultural Significance of Beef in Korean Cuisine

Historically, beef was a luxury in Korea, reserved for special occasions, royalty, and honored guests. This reverence for beef is deeply embedded in the culture and informs the way it is prepared and consumed. Every part of the animal is utilized, and specific cuts are prized for their unique textures and flavors. This cultural context is vital. When a diner enjoys a meal at Mongtan, they are not just eating grilled meat; they are partaking in a tradition of hospitality and celebration. This is the essence of an Authentic Korean Beef experienceone that is rich with history and meaning, a story further explored in the in-depth analysis of Mongtan's US market invasion. This understanding informs every aspect of the dining experience, from the way the meat is sliced to the accompaniments it is served with.
